Gemstone origin and historical past: Sphalerita has an interesting record. It absolutely was often known as ‘Blende,’ a German phrase employed to describe a yellow or black stone that doesn't comprise steel but seems like metallic. The miners while in the sixteenth century referred to it like a stone that ‘blinds and deceives.’ However, from the 18th century, a chemist named Georg Brandt found this stone to contain zinc ore. Nevertheless, Portion of the previous legendary identify remains to be While using the stone as ‘Sphalerite’ arises from ‘Sphaleros,’ a Greek term that means ‘deceiving.’

Gemstone origin and historical past: Citrine was The most valued gemstones in the ancient Greek and Roman civilizations. They thought that the intense coloration with the stone will help brighten existence and diminish damaging energies. From the early seventeenth century, citrine was utilized by the craftsmen of Scotland to enhance their weapons. Queen Victoria was very accountable read more for the enormous attractiveness of citrine inside the romantic period of time, as most of her brooches, kilt pins, and dubhs experienced citrine in them.
